Well, I picked up the 380 this morning. It has a black rail, and limbs, quiver, and cheek piece. Contacted seller, and he said his yes reply was to my other question, but would take the item back, no questions. I told him to let me think about it. Called Danny Miller about the rail, he said it is tougher than the camo rail, and advised me to keep the bow at the price I paid. He also said, get the camo limbs from Excalibur if the black ones really bother me. Contacted Dawn, and for $110 to my door, camo limbs are a coming. The stirrup is dipped, it has the limb dampeners, string wings, string gizmos for the inside of the limbs, I'm not installing those, and swapped out the S5 stops for Danny Miller's. Twisting a string for it that will be ready Sunday. I'll finish the assembly then.
